Serba Serbi PHP Lama

Server tempat hosting saya mengalami kerusakan SSD. Padahal saya menaruh skrip disitu karena masih mendukung PHP 5.6.

Kalau SSD rusak tentu saja restore backup. Dan biasanya tidak sempurna. PHP 5.6 tidak ada, error PHP tidak bisa keluar dan sebagainya. Akhirnya sayalah yang harus mengalah. Menyesuaikan skrip dengan PHP 7.2, yang paling dekat dengan  PHP 5.6 dan yang tersedia di server.

Untungnya dulu skrip dibuat menggunakan layer DB sehingga ketika harus pindah dari mysql_query ke mysqli_query segalahnya menjadi mudah.

Karena tidak ada error yang keluar di server akhirnya saya terpaksa menjalankannya di komputer lokal. Saya install php 7.4  dan dengan menggunakan internal server php error menjadi lebih mudah diketahui.

/usr/bin/php7.5 -S localhost:7000

Ternyata hasilnya skrip keluar semua karena pada waktu itu saya masih banyak menggunakan short_open_tag. Hadeh …

Dan ternyata ada caranya :
/usr/bin/php7.4 -d short_open_tag=1 -S localhost:7000

Dan Skrip pun berjalan dengan baik.

Spread the love

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.